If your Panny 58""! is capable of displaying 720p (check your tvs instruction manual)then either of the hidef formats would look very good especially if you sit within 4 metres of your screen. With Blur-ray:evil4:, you might want to hang on a few months as they are still developing features were current profile 1.0 and 1.1 players will be obselete. The exception being Sony's PS3 which allows firmware upgrades to bring it bang up to date with new features.
